Jefferson Healthcare is seeking a skilled and organized Medical Assistant-Certified to join our Watership Clinic team. Our Medical Assistants play a crucial role in ensuring the smooth operation of our clinic and in delivering an exceptional experience for our patients.

In this multifaceted position, you will serve as the first point of contact for patients, guiding them through their visits with professionalism and empathy. Your role will directly support physicians, nurses, and the administrative team, contributing to the overall efficiency and quality of care provided by our practice. As part of your responsibilities, you will assist with clinical tasks such as recording vital signs, preparing patients for examinations, administering injections and vaccinations, and maintaining organized records in our electronic medical record system.

This role requires someone who thrives in a fast-paced environment, has exceptional attention to detail, and demonstrates the ability to multitask effectively. Compassion, discretion, and a commitment to patient privacy and satisfaction are essential qualities for success. What you'll need:

  • High School diploma or GED required
  • Current Washington State certification in good standing; MA-C or LPN required
  • BLS/CPR certification required
  • Two years of experience preferred
  • Must stay current in knowledge base, certifications, and licenses required and meet Hospital-mandated education requirements
  • Experienced MA-C's and new grads welcome!

Schedule: 1.0 FTE; 40 hours/week, Day Shift; five 8-hour shifts
